How is the Company developing its people to ensure that a strong management team is in place for the future?
A. Reuben Mark: Colgate has a formal Global Succession Planning Process that identifies next-generation leaders early in their careers. Recommended by their functional managers, future leaders are brought to the attention of senior management to ensure that they gain diverse in-market experience across geographies and functions. All senior managers are extremely knowledgeable about Colgate’s culture, practices and policies, and are truly committed to the long-term success of Colgate and its future leaders.
